This week we met “Phoebe” the cat.

Here is some information on Phoebe from the Humane Society of Ocean City:

“Phoebe is a one-year-old sweet petite female domestic short-haired tuxedo cat. While looking like a kitten herself, Phoebe was rescued off the streets along with four week-old baby kittens. Phoebe was fortunate enough to have been placed into a loving foster home until her kittens were old enough to receive first vaccinations.

The HSOC had already committed to the 4 babies when they were ready but what to do with our little mama Phoebe?

Everyone wants kittens but doesn't Phoebe deserve her second chance at finding her forever home too? After all, she had been such a good mom. At present, all of her babies have been adopted. Phoebe continues to wait for her chance. She is a vocal, playful affectionate cat. She has met dogs before but not on a regular basis so she may be okay with a canine friend. She also do fine with kids over the age of 10.

Although she would prefer to be the queen of her castle, we believe she would deal with other cats well. Would Phoebe be a fit in your house? Come visit and see for yourself!”

If you would like to visit Phoebe or need more information about any animal up for adoption at The Humane Society of Ocean City, call 609-399-2018 or stop in any day between 11a-3p.To adopt from the HSOC you will need one form of identification, which includes your name, permanent address and proof of ownership (i.e., local tax stub). If you rent, written approval from your landlord is required as well as personal identification.The adoption fee is $50.00 for cats or kittens and $85 for dogs, adults and puppies.

They accept cash, Visa, MasterCard, Discover and debit cards. Checks are accepted upon management’s approval. All adoptions include spay/neuter surgery, microchip if requested, free first vet exam, and all necessary vaccinations through the first year. Adoption applications are available at the shelter.
